Ok i recently upgraded my pc from an EVGA GTX 950 SC+ to a EVGA GTX 1050 FTW. With my testing, the 1050 had a 5-9% avg higher than the 950 in games like GTAV, BeamNG Drive But in MSI Kombustor the 950 outperformed the 1050 by 30-40 fps, so i was wondering if i could flash my 950 with an EVGA GTX 950 FTW Bios, I'm pretty sure the cooler can handle it.

Solution
I hate to tell you but 950 to 1050 is not an upgrade. Yes the 1050 is a better performing card in most cases but not enough to count as an upgrade. Considering the CPU you have, why are you messing with 2gb budget videocards? So in the end no bios is going to change things. The 950/1050 and 960/1050 Ti and 970/1060 are how it breaks down in terms of performance in the last two Nvidia generations.
